GB8181-2025
Fire nozzles
消防水枪
GB 8181-2025 is an upcoming mandatory Chinese national standard for Fire nozzles. It appears in the Construction compliance cluster with a product safety focus and has an implementation date of Aug 1, 2026.

Compliance overview
Scope and applicability
This standard applies to the design, manufacturing, and acceptance of fire nozzles with a working pressure ranging from 0.20 MPa to 4.0 MPa and a flow rate not exceeding 16 L/s. It covers various types of equipment, including low, medium, and high-pressure water guns, as well as combination and multi-purpose nozzles. This standard does not apply to pulse pneumatic spray fire nozzles.
Technical requirements
The standard specifies comprehensive performance criteria for fire nozzles, focusing on basic parameters such as rated flow, reach, and spray angle under specific pressure conditions. It details structural and operational requirements, mandating that moving parts must be easily operable while wearing XF 7 fire gloves, and sets strict limits on the operating torque for switches and rotating components. Manufacturers must ensure that all switching mechanisms, including flow rate and spray pattern adjustments, operate smoothly without sticking. Material and physical durability requirements are extensive, covering the use of compliant casting alloys, O-rings, and specific threading profiles. The nozzles must withstand rigorous environmental and mechanical stresses, including anti-drop performance, salt spray corrosion, and extreme temperature exposures ranging from -30°C to +55°C. Non-metallic critical components must also pass aging tests for heat, UV radiation, and warm water exposure without functional degradation. Additionally, the standard outlines specific requirements for nozzle interfaces, mandating compliance with the GB 12514 series, and introduces a flushing function requirement for guided low-pressure combination nozzles. Permanent markings, comprehensive user manuals, and robust packaging are mandatory to ensure proper identification and safe transport.
Testing methods
The standard outlines a series of rigorous evaluation procedures, including flow and reach measurement tests to verify basic parameters, and structural inspections to ensure operability with fire gloves. It mandates reciprocating operation tests (300 cycles) to evaluate the durability of rotating and switching components under rated pressure. Environmental and durability assessments include drop tests, salt spray exposure, thermal aging, UV radiation, and extreme temperature cycling. Furthermore, it specifies hydrostatic pressure tests, sealing performance checks, and specific flushing capability assessments using standardized steel balls.
FAQs
What products are regulated under GB 8181-2025?
GB 8181-2025 applies to fire nozzles with a working pressure of 0.20 MPa to 4.0 MPa and a flow rate not exceeding 16 L/s. It does not apply to pulse pneumatic spray nozzles.
Are there any updates from the previous version of GB 8181?
The 2025 version introduces several updates, including revised basic parameters and operating torque requirements. It also adds new performance and testing methods for reciprocating operation, thermal air aging, UV radiation resistance, warm water aging, and a flushing function for specific low-pressure nozzles.
How does GB 8181-2025 differ from international ISO standards?
GB 8181-2025 is a Chinese national standard tailored for the domestic fire equipment market, specifying unique structural and operational requirements, such as compatibility with XF 7 fire gloves and specific flushing functions. Manufacturers must comply with this standard to sell fire nozzles in China, regardless of ISO compliance.
